I have a 2004 MTD riding mower that runs great but won't go in 1st or 2nd gear. I replace the belt just about a week ago. 3rd, 4th, 5th gear runs great but not 1st and 2nd. I tried to adjust it but I can't figure out how to. I have a manual for it, but it doesn't show you much. Please Help!!!

Two things make sure to use MTD OEM belts, otherwise they won't work for long. The other thing is to change both belts at the same time, because they have to sync to work properly. A worn belt will throw this off kilter.

Try this.
Put it in 4th and go a short distance and turn the key switch off not touching anything else. Not the brake, clutch no nothing. Get off and feel the tension on the two motion drive belts. They should feel approximately the same with both having tension.

Now start it up and do the same in 1st and report back on belt tension of the two belts.
